Anda di halaman 1dari 12

MAKALAH

LOGIKA DAN ALGORITMA PEMROGRAMAN

Dosen pengampu : Azlin, S.Kom., M. T

Oleh:

FITRATUN NAZILA

23650044

KELAS B

FAKULTAS TEKNIK

JURUSAN INFORMATIKA

UNIVERSITAS DAYANU IKHSANUDDIN

BAUBAU

2023

1
KATA PENGANTAR

Puji syukur kehadirat tuhan yang maha kuasa karena telah memberikan
kesempatan pada saya untuk menyelesaikan makalah ini. Atas rahmat dan
hidayah-Nyalah sehingga saya dapat menyelesaikan makalah ini tepat waktu.

Makalah ini disusun guna memenuhi tugas dosen pada mata kuliah Logika
Dan Algoritma Pemrograman di Universitas Dayanu Ikhsanuddin .Selain itu,
kami juga berharap agar makalah ini dapat menambah wawasan bagi pembaca.

Kami mengucapkan terima kasih kepada semua pihak yang telah


membantu proses pembuatan makalah ini. Semoga tugas yang telah diberikan ini
dapat menambah pengetahuan dan wawasan terkait bidang yang ditekuni. Oleh
karena itu kritik dan saran yang membangun akan kami terima demi
kesempurnaan makalah ini.

Baubau, 15 Oktober 2023

FITRATUN NAZILA

ii
DAFTAR ISI

KATA PENGANTAR.............................................................................................ii
DAFTAR ISI..........................................................................................................iii
BAB I PENDAHULUAN........................................................................................1
1.1 Latar Belakang...............................................................................................1
1.2 Rumusan Masalah..........................................................................................2
1.3 Tujuan.............................................................................................................2
BAB II PEMBAHASAN.........................................................................................3
2.1 Sejarah C++....................................................................................................3
2.2 Tutorial menginstal C++................................................................................3
2.3 Cara Menggunakan Pemrograman C++.........................................................6
BAB III PENUTUP.................................................................................................8
Kesimpulan...........................................................................................................8
Saran.....................................................................................................................8
Daftar Pustaka.......................................................................................................9

iii
BAB I
PENDAHULUAN

1.1 Latar Belakang


Sebuah komputer tidak dapat mengerjakan apapun tanpa adanya
perintah dari manusia. Perintah – perintah yang terstruktur dan sistematis
untuk membuat agar komputer dapat bekerja sesuai dengan apa yang
diinginkan disebut program. Komputer dapat diprogram untuk berbagai hal
misalnya untuk melakukan perhitungan suatu ekspresi matematika,
memainkan lagu, mengurutkan sekumpulan data, melakukan permainan
(games), menggambar dan sebagainya. Program-program semacam itu dibuat
oleh manusia, syarat utama dalam membuat program komputer adalah
perintah-perintah yang diberikan dalam program tersebut harus dimengerti
oleh komputer. Komputer hanya dapat mengerti sebuah bahasa yang disebut
bahasa mesin. Bahasa yang sangat berbeda dengan bahasa manusia dan
terlebih lagi akan amat menyulitkan untuk membuat sebuah program dalam
bahasa mesin ini. Manusia menginginkan sebuah bahasa komputer yang
sederhana yang dapat dimengerti dan mudah dipelajari oleh manusia sekaligus
dapat dimengerti oleh komputer. Bahasa komputer tersebut disebut bahasa
pemrograman (programming language). Yang perlu diingat, konsep bahasa
pemrograman adalah merubah/menerjemahkan perintah-perintah (program)
yang diberikan oleh manusia ke dalam bahasa mesin yang dapat dimengerti
oleh komputer. Saat ini banyak bahasa pemrograman yang beredar di pasaran.
Masing – masing memberikan kemudahan dan fasilitas untuk membuat
sebuah program komputer yang sesuai dengan keinginan, salah satunya bahasa
C
Bahasa C yang diciptakan oleh Brian W. Kernighan dan Dennis M.
Ritchie pada tahun 1972 di laboratorium Bell AT&T. Bahasa ini
menggabungkan kemampuan pengendalian mesin dalam aras rendah dan
struktur data serta struktur kontrol aras tinggi. Jadi dapat disebut bahasa C
adalah bahasa pemrograman yang menggabungkan kemudahan pengontrolan
hardware dalam bahasa pemrograman tingkat rendah serta struktur kontrol
dalam bahasa tingkat tingg. Pada tahun 1983, Bjarne Stroustrup

1
mengembangkan bahasa C yang pada mulanya disebut sebagai ”a better C ”.
Namun kemudian bahasa ini dikenal dengan nama C++ ( C plus plus) yang
mengunggulkan kelebihannya sebagai bahasa pemrograman berorientasi
objek.
Bahasa pemrograman yang digunakan adalah bahasa C yang ditulis
dengan menggunakan editor C++. Bahasa C dipilih karena bahasa C
merupakan bahasa yang menjadi dasar bahasa – bahasa pemrograman baru
sekarang ini, seperti java, C++, C#, PHP, JavaScript, dan lain – lain. Bahasa C
seringkali disebut sebagai ibu dari bahasa pemrograman. kali ini penulis
sebagai salah seorang mahasiswa yang sedang mencoba membuat sebuah
aplikasi penghitungan nilai ujian dan indeks prestasi mahasiswa Teknik
Komputer berbasis PEMROGRAMAN BAHASA C dengan
mengguanakan C++ sebagai tools pembantunya. Aplikasi ini dibuat untuk
mempermudah dan mempercepat belajar dasar – dasar pemprograman bahasa
C. Pengolahan data nilai dan perhitungan nilai ip masih sering menggunakan
cara manual atau aplikasi yang tidak stand alone dan lebih mudah
dikembangkan.

1.2 Rumusan Masalah


1. Jelaskan sejarah C++?
2. Bagaimana Tutorial menginstal C++?
3. Cara menggunakan Pemrograman C++?

1.3 Tujuan
1. Untuk mengetahui dan memahami sejarah C++
2. Untuk mengetahui dan memahami Tutorial menginstal C++
3. Untuk mengetahui dan memahami Cara menggunakan Pemrograman
C++

2
BAB II
PEMBAHASAN

2.1 Sejarah C++

Bahasa C++ diciptakan oleh Bjarne Stroustrup di AT&T Bell Laboratories awal
tahun 1980-an berdasarkan C ANSI (American National Standard Institute). Pertama kali,
prototype C++ muncul sebagai C yang dipercanggih dengan fasilitas kelas. Bahasa
tersebut disebut C dengan kelas ( C wih class).
Selama tahun 1983-1984, C dengan kelas disempurnakan dengan menambahkan fasilitas
pembebanlebihan operator dan fungsi yang kemudian melahirkan apa yang disebut C++.
Symbol ++ merupakan operator C untuk operasi penaikan, muncul untuk menunjukkan
bahwa bahasa baru ini merupakan versi yang lebih canggih dari C.

Borland International merilis compiler Borland C++ dan Turbo C++. Kedua
compiler ini sama-sama dapat digunakan untuk mengkompilasi kode C++. Bedanya,
Borland C++ selain dapat digunakan dibawah lingkungan DOS, juga dapat digunakan
untuk pemrograman Windows. Selain Borland International, beberapa perusahaan lain
juga merilis compiler C++, seperti Topspeed C++ dan Zortech C++.

Bahasa C dikembangken di Bell lab pada tahun 1972 yang ditulis pertama kali
oleh Brian W. Kernighan dan Denies M. Ricthie merupakan bahasa turunan atau
pengembangan dari bahasa B yang ditulis oleh Ken Thompson pada tahun 1970 yang
diturunkan dari bahasa sebelumnya, yaitu BCL. Bahasa C, pada awalnya dirancang
sebagai bahasa pemrograman yang dioperasikan pada sistem operasi UNIX. Bahasa C
merupakan bahasa pemrograman yang berada diantara bahasa tingkat rendah dan tingkat
tinggi yang biasa disebut dengan Bahasa Tingkat Menengah. Bahasa C mempunyai
banyak kemampuan yang sering digunakan diantaranya kemampuan untuk membuat
perangkat lunak, misalnya dBASE, Word Star dan lain-lain.

2.2 Tutorial menginstal C++


Berikut Tutorial cara mnginsal C++ adalah sebagai berikut:

Cara Instal Dev C++ :


1. Siapkan Installer Dev C++. Jika belum ada, bisa kunjungi
link: http://filehippo.com/download_dev-c/ untuk download file nya.
2. Setelah bahan sudah siap. Buka installer yang sudah di download tadi. maka akan
muncul seperti pada gambar dan tunggu beberapa saat.

3
3. Pilih English. Lalu klik OK.

4. Setelah itu klik I Agree.

5. Lalu klik Next

6. Setelah itu klik Instal.


4
7. Tunggu proses extract selesai kurang lebih 2-3 menit.

8. Setelah proses extract selesai ceklis Run Dev C++ lalu klik Finish.

9. Maka akan muncul tab first time configuration. Klik next.

10. Setelah itu klik OK.

5
11. Selamat aplikasi Dev C++ sudah berhasil terinstal di laptop / komputer anda.

2.3 Cara Menggunakan Pemrograman C++

Cara Menggunakan Dev-C++


1. Pilih menu file di pojok kiri atas lalu pilih new >> source file

2. Disinilah tempat mengetik coding nya

6
3. Sekarang coba anda copy code dibawah ini dan paste di Dev-C++

1 // Cara menggunakan C++


2
3 #include<iostream>
4
5 main()
6 {
7 std::cout<<"Hallo semua";
8 }

4. Klik menu execute lalu pilh compile and run. untuk mengeksekusi program

7
BAB III
PENUTUP

A. Kesimpulan
Bahasa C adalah bahasa pemrograman yang menggabungkan
kemudahan pengontrolan hardware dalam bahasa pemrograman tingkat
rendah serta struktur kontrol dalam bahasa tingkat tingg. Pada tahun 1983,
Bjarne Stroustrup mengembangkan bahasa C yang pada mulanya disebut
sebagai ”a better C ”. Namun kemudian bahasa ini dikenal dengan nama
C++ ( C plus plus) yang mengunggulkan kelebihannya sebagai bahasa
pemrograman berorientasi objek.
Bahasa pemrograman yang digunakan adalah bahasa C yang ditulis
dengan menggunakan editor C++. Bahasa C dipilih karena bahasa C
merupakan bahasa yang menjadi dasar bahasa – bahasa pemrograman baru
sekarang ini, seperti java, C++, C#, PHP, JavaScript, dan lain – lain

B. Saran
Sebagai mahasiswa Teknik sudah sewajarnya kita harus
mengetahui dan memahami bahkan mendalami hal-hal yang terkait dengan
ilmu informatika utamanya mempelajari logika dan algoritma
pemograman serta ruang lingkup pembahasannya. Karena dapat menjadi
acuan dan pegangan kita pada saat terjun kedunia kerja yang memiliki
berbagai macam masalah dan kesulitan

8
Daftar Pustaka
Putrinabilav (2018) Sejarah C++, Pengertian dan Perkembangan C++, struktur C++, dan
contoh membuat program menggunakan CodeBlocks
https://putrinabilav.wordpress.com/2018/02/11/sejarahpengertian-dan-
perkembanganstrukturdan-contoh-membuat-program-menggunakan-codeblocks/

Unknown (2017) Cara menginstal Dev C++ di laptop/komputer


https://maribelajarrpl.blogspot.com/2017/09/cara-menginstal-dev-c-di-laptop-
komputer.html

Dhimas (2017) Cara menggunakan Dev C++


https://rasikomputer.blogspot.com/2017/01/cara-menggunakan-dev-c.html

Anda mungkin juga menyukai